The Cleveland Huntington Beach Soft #10.5C Putter is an excellent choice for players with a straight putting stroke seeking a stable and forgiving putter. The putter offers forgiveness with a large sweet spot, ensuring consistent line and power, even on off-center hits. Its balanced design, substantial weight, and ideal shaft placement make it easy to control. It is a budget-friendly yet high-quality option for those seeking accuracy and precision on the greens.

Expert Reviews of the Cleveland Huntington Beach Soft #10.5C Putter

Calvin Max What impresses me most about this mallet is how much weight is in such a compact package. The putter seems impossibly smaller than its brothers of the line because of its square shape. When I set it down at address, it set up "open." One of the idiosyncrasies of my game is that I tend to set up with all of my clubs slightly closed at address, so I was fascinated to see it reversed with this model. The geometric steps on either side of the back channel are my favorite aspect of its looks. My favorite thing about its performance is how well it is balanced, how easy it is to get the putter moving back, and how hard it is to overpower a putt.

Review Ratings

Alignment

3/5
Calvin Max gave 3 of 5 stars. I was somewhat unamused during testing to find that this putter liked to line up to the right. Inexplicably, on every other putt, I would look from the hole back to the putter to find that I had rotated the face slightly open. While undoubtedly a personal problem, it was persistent enough that I felt the need to bring it up. I also missed almost all of my putts out right, so I suspect the opening I was doing also carried through to my stroke.

Grip

4/5
Calvin Max gave 4 of 5 stars. Two grip types come available on these putters: a pistol-style blue Cleveland branded grip and the now ubiquitous SuperStrokes. I am a great fan of the former and would like never to see the latter again. Fortunately, I found a pistol grip variant, which complements the head's weight well. This putter does not need the additional stability of an oversized grip.

Forgiveness

4/5
Calvin Max gave 4 of 5 stars. The sweet spot on this putter is practically the entire face. However, it's weighted so well that it is challenging to get offline. Missed strikes to the toe are "punished," if I can call it that, more than those toward the heel. During testing, I never sent a ball more than six inches away from the hole on either side. I missed plenty long, but even my bad putts had a chance.

Feel

4/5
Calvin Max gave 4 of 5 stars. I was impressed by how easy it was to keep this putter on line and how easy it was to judge power during testing. The head has some substantial weight, making it easy to let it do the work. 

FAQs

What do you love about this product?

Calvin Max What I love most about the HB Soft #10.5C is the ideal shaft placement. It seems to be a minor feature but speaks to the effort and thought put into this flatstick. The shaft's uppermost curve perfectly aligns with the alignment sight line.

What was your favorite moment with this gear?

Calvin Max My favorite moment with this putter was when I missed 15 consecutive putts that all finished within eight inches of the hole. Typically, on a practice green, I only have three balls, but I was testing, so I had a whole pile of them, and the result was this hilarious congregation of narrowly missed 15-footers.
